Record-Tying Feat: El Cajon's Jimmie Johnson Wins Third Consecutive NASCAR Championship

Sunday November 16, 2008
He has cemented his place as one of stock car racing's greatest drivers, and El Cajon gets to claim Jimmie Johnson as its very own. The native son entered the NASCAR record books today by winning his third consecutive championship with a solid 15th-place run at the Homestead 400 in Miami, beating Edwards by 69 points to join Cale Yarborough as the only drivers in NASCAR history to win three straight titles.

The 32-year-old Johnson's racing career started in El Cajon on 50cc motorcycles at the age of five. His father, Gary, worked for a tire company and his mother, Cathy, drove a school bus. With Jimmie and younger brothers Jarit and Jessie in tow, the family spent most of their weekends camping and doing what they loved - racing.

Johnson and wife, Chandra, promote the Jimmie Johnson Foundation with a variety of public fundraising activities. In March of 2007, the couple opened Jimmie Johnson's Victory Lanes for campers at Kyle and Pattie Petty's Victory Junction Camp in Randleman, N.C. Johnson resides in Charlotte, N.C.
